From UNESCO site to housekeeping: 5 things you didn’t know about Indian Railways

Indian Railways boasts three UNESCO World Heritage railway sites, showcasing engineering marvels. Dedicated housekeeping teams maintain cleanliness across its vast network of stations and trains. The railway system operates the world's longest network, connecting diverse geographical regions of India. Some stations possess unique architectural designs and historical significance, like Ghum Railway Station. Indian Railways also manages its own medical, engineering, and security systems for operations.
